First Biker Across Three Longest Highways of India new
R Chiranthana (b July 22, 1973) of Bengaluru successfully completed the first ever two-wheeler solo expedition connecting India’s three longest highways in a single ride, covering 21,312 km in 67 days. Setting out from Bengaluru at 11.09 am on August 22, 2022 on a Yamaha FZS (v2) bike, he covered the North-South Corridor (Kanyakumari – Srinagar, including Salem - Kochi spur route), the East-West Corridor (Porbandar – Silchar) and the Golden Quadrilateral (Mumbai – Delhi – Kolkata – Chennai) in that order, and returned to Bengaluru at 11.30 am on Oct 27, 2022.
